Description:

NephroCare High Protein Formula is a scientifically formulated renal-specific nutritional supplement designed to support the dietary needs of individuals with chronic kidney disease (CKD), especially those on dialysis therapy. It offers high biological value protein, balanced calories, and controlled electrolytes (low sodium, potassium, and phosphorus) to help manage the nutritional needs and metabolic balance of renal patients.

Enriched with whey protein isolate, essential amino acids, and omega-3 fatty acids, this formula helps prevent muscle wasting, supports tissue repair, and promotes overall recovery without overloading the kidneys.

Usage Information

Dosage

Recommended Serving: 1–2 scoops (approximately 25–50 g) per day mixed with 150–200 ml of lukewarm water or milk. Intake should be tailored by a physician or renal dietitian depending on the patient’s dialysis type, protein requirement, and urea levels.

Side Effects

No major side effects when used as per medical guidance Excessive intake may cause metabolic imbalance or overload May cause mild gastrointestinal discomfort in sensitive individuals

Contraindications

Not for parenteral (IV) use Not suitable for patients with protein-restricted (non-dialysis) stages unless advised Avoid in case of allergy to milk protein (whey/casein) or soy (if applicable) Use with caution in hepatic failure patients
